disqualification period, period of disqualification

Konkursrådet provides the following information in English and Norwegian:

Konkurskarantene
Bobestyreren skal i sin innberetning til skifteretten gi opplysning om det foreligger forhold som kan gi grunn til konkurskarantene.[...]

Disqualification period
In the report to the Bankruptcy Court the trustee must provide information on whether there are circumstances that suggest that a disqualification period should be imposed. [...]


There is a lot of valuable information in English about Norwegian bankruptcy law at the website of the Norwegian Advisory Council on Bankruptcy (konkursrådet)
